Middle Backend Engineer (Go / PostgreSQL / Kafka / Kubernetes)

Уровень дохода не указан

Опыт работы: 1–3 года

Полная занятость

График: 5/2

Рабочие часы: 8

Формат работы: на месте работодателя

Напишите телефон, чтобы работодатель мог связаться с вами

Пройдите капчу
Чтобы подтвердить, что вы не робот, введите текст с картинки:
captcha
Неверный текст. Пожалуйста, повторите попытку.

Формат: Офис / Гибрид

Инфраструктура: cloud-native k8s

Стек: Go 1.24, PostgreSQL, Redis, Kafka / RabbitMQ, Docker, Kubernetes

Что предстоит делать

Разработка розничных финтех-продуктов
Продуктовая разработка в кроссфункциональных командах. Предстоит работать над функционалом для физлиц, бизнеса и внутренних сотрудников в области переводов (включая трансграничные) и автоматизации банковских операций.

Интеграции
Писать интеграционные сервисы и API с внешними платёжными провайдерами, внутренними реестрами, шинами событий.

Системы хранения и очереди
Проектировать отказоустойчивые системы с использованием PostgreSQL, Redis и брокеров сообщений.

Технический дизайн
Разрабатывать модули по принципам Clean Architecture, с раздельными слоями и контрактами, автогенерацией клиентских SDK и схем.

Инфраструктура
Собирать образы, писать Dockerfile, настраивать Kubernetes-манифесты (на базе microk8s), деплоить сервисы в тестовый периметр. В прод катят девопсы

Проектный процесс
Работаем по Kanban, всё ведём в OpenProject, код — в GitLab, ревью обязательны.

Минимум митингов — максимум фокуса.

Обязательные требования

  • 2+ года коммерческого опыта в разработке на Go.

  • Отличное знание стандартной библиотеки Go 1.18+, уверенная работа с context, net/http, time, errors, encoding/*.

  • Опыт написания REST API, опыт с fasthttp.

  • Уверенное понимание Clean Architecture: слои, зависимости, интерфейсы, DI.

  • PostgreSQL: умение писать сложные SQL-запросы, миграции, индексы.

  • Redis: кэш, TTL.

  • Kafka или RabbitMQ: продюсеры/консьюмеры, схемы сообщений, requeue & dead-letter.

  • Понимание принципов контейнеризации, опыт написания Dockerfile и Kubernetes YAML для сервисов.

  • Опыт работы с GitLab, CI/CD пайплайнами, знание Gitflow.

  • Внимательность, умение тестировать себя, проверять бизнес-правила руками и глазами.

  • Умение читать и писать документацию, тикеты, описания PR.

Будет плюсом

  • Опыт настройки и работы с microk8s.

  • Навыки работы с protobuf/gRPC и protoc генерацией.

  • Знание систем очередей в деталях: ручная маршрутизация, backoff, обработка фейлов.

  • Опыт написания операторов / CronJob'ов в Kubernetes.

  • Примеры продакшн-кода в открытом доступе / участие в open-source.

  • Опыт в разработке финтех-систем, особенно с трансграничной спецификой (SWIFT, SEPA, ISO 20022).

Что мы предлагаем:

  • Интересные задачи в области автоматизации сложных банковских процессов.
  • Работа в финтех подразделении — возможность влиять на архитектуру, стек, процессы.
  • Наставничество и рост до Senior/Tech Lead.
  • Оформление по ТК РФ, гибкий график, 28 дней отпуска.
  • Прозрачная грейд-матрица и ревью каждые 6 месяцев.
  • Комфортный офис, закрытый контур, без бюрократии.

Как проходит отбор:

  1. Созвон 15 мин с рекрутером — знакомство.

  2. Техническое интервью 60 мин — очно/удаленно. Опционально Live coding.

  3. Финальный созвон — оффер.


Если тебе близка работа на стыке Go, инфраструктуры и финтеха — будем рады видеть тебя в команде!

Ключевые навыки

  • Golang
  • Apache Kafka
  • Redis

Задайте вопрос работодателю

Он получит его с откликом на вакансию

Где предстоит работать

Москва, Давыдково, Немчиновка, Рабочий Посёлок, Сетунь, Сколковское шоссе, вл43

Вакансия опубликована 17 сентября 2025 в Москве

Похожие вакансии